    Quote Originally Posted by Nacht View Post
    Unless they changed it, you have to hit F1, F2, F3, etc before using <stal> or <stpt>. It's the reason I've stuck with <stpc>. But I also don't bitch about people swapping gear.
    If you have <stal> or <stpt> in a macro, you do not need a current target selected. Using either in a macro allows you to select a character via the party list on the right side of the screen using Up/Down and does not move your target cursor. Whereas the <stpc> and <stnpc> commands require you to tab around to find your target.
